| siva kumar | sivakumarkp@fastmail.fm | Question | Windows | 2.7.8 | background color and font | Stefan,
i recently download the elog server for windows and configured. its working with me fine
i would like to configure my elog server for to display a different color when am giving a specific "value" for a attribute "Status".
from the documentation i found to use the
Style Status Fixed = background-color:green
but with this configuration, the entire raw will be with red color or the specified color. i am looking only for that specific box (Status column) to be with specific color.
my configuration is as follows
Attributes = Author, Type, Category, Subject, Location, Problem Description, Status
Options Status = Fixed, Under Process, Not Fixed
Style Status Fixed = background-color:green
Style Status Not Fixed = background-color:red
Style Status Under Process = background-color:yellow
Am attaching two images, one is current display and next one is what i am looking for
am not sure about will it possible or not. please guide me. if it possible with javascript please tell me how i can include a external javascript for this pupose.
Thanks in advance
siva |

I have added a new option for you:
Cell Style <attribute> <value> = ...
which does exactly that. The new version is 2.7.8-5 is ready for download. |
